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32 070535453 25858
606338 218834 452
606338 218834 452
147117 04665 6737148651
All about undefined
Interested in learning more?
606338 218834 452
147117 04665 6737148651
See more
695431605 4418 7654022613
3896256412 9708756 56406
See more
96343 67624151748 1279241
25789 46095 0152019362
See more